多特征融合的行人检测方法

文档序号:6551756阅读:187来源:国知局
多特征融合的行人检测方法
【专利摘要】本发明公开了一种多特征融合的行人检测方法,步骤如下:1)特征设计,即对于输入样本图像计算随机特征,统计特征概率分布直方图;2)构造树分类器,即从多个特征概率分布直方图中选择判别能力较强的特征,形成树分类器;3)构造森林分类器,即由多个树分类器生成一个森林分类器;4)构造集成森林分类器,即由多个森林分类器生成集成森林分类器;5)使用集成森林分类器对行人进行检测。本发明方案计算效率高,为实时处理提供了有利条件。另外,从大量随机特征中选出较强判别能力的特征,利用多种随机特征进行融合有效的提高了行人检测效率。
【专利说明】多特征融合的行人检测方法

【技术领域】
[0001] 本发明涉及计算机视觉和模式识别领域,更具体地说,涉及一种使用多种特征融 合的行人检测方法。

【背景技术】
[0002] 行人检测是指在输入图像或者视频序列中将人体区域从背景中分割出来的过程。 行人检测作为人体运动的视觉分析中的一项关键技术,近年来在诸如视频监控、机器人、智 能交通和高级人机交互等计算机视觉领域中有着广泛的应用。
[0003] 在行人检测中,由于极易受到光照、自身姿态、服饰等众多因素的影响,使得准确 无误的检测行人有非常大的难度。行人检测的常用方法是基于统计分类的方法,即将行人 检测看作是对行人和非行人两个类别进行分类的问题。其主要包括两个关键步骤:1、提取 行人特征;2、采用模式识别方法进行分类。特征提取的目的是降低数据的维数,得到能反映 模式本质属性的特征,方便后面的分类;分类器设计属于机器学习领域的范畴,其目的是得 到一个计算复杂度较低,并且推广性较好的分类器。因此,如何提取有效的行人特征对行人 检测至关重要。
[0004] 根据特征描述的不同,行人特征可以分为底层特征、基于学习的特征和混合特征。
[0005] 底层特征指的是颜色、纹理和梯度等基本的图像特征。Dalai等提出 HOG (Histogram of Oriented Gradient)是目前广泛使用的行人特征描述子。H0G刻画图像 的局部梯度幅值和方向特征,对光照变化和小量的偏移并不敏感,能有效地刻画出人体的 边缘特征.但H0G也有其缺点,比如维度高、计算慢。另外还有Ojala等提出的一种用于纹 理分类的特征提取方法,即局部二值模式(Local Binary Pattern, LBP),其计算速度相对 较快,但对于低分辨率下判别能力较差。
[0006] 基于学习的特征指的是通过机器学习的方法,从大量的行人样本中学习到的行 人特征表示。基于学习的特征,利用Boosting进行特征选择,选择出来的特征可看作是 行人的中间层表示。利用AdaBoost从大量的Haar特征中选择判别能力较强的特征(弱分 类器),应用在行人检测中。
[0007] 混合特征指的是多种底层特征的融合,或者是底层特征的高阶统计特征。Tuzel 等利用各种不同特征,如象素的坐标、灰度的一阶导数、二阶导数和梯度方向等的协方差矩 阵来描述行人的局部区域特征。Watanabe等则采用类似灰度共生矩阵的特征,提出了共生 梯度方向直方图特征(Co-occurrence Histograms of Oriented Gradients,简称 CoHOG)。 CoHOG通过"梯度对"更好地描述了梯度的空间分布特征,其缺点主要是向量维度太高。


【发明内容】

[0008] 本发明的目的在于,针对上述行人检测技术中,行人检测实时性差或者准确率低 的问题,提出一种提取随机特征的方法,并且从大量随机特征中选出较强判别能力的特征, 利用多种随机特征进行融合来达到有效行人检测的目的。
[0009] 实现本发明目的的技术方案为:该方法包括以下过程。
[0010] 1)特征设计,即对于输入样本图像计算随机特征,统计特征概率分布直方图;
[0011] 2)构造树分类器,即从多个特征概率分布直方图中选择判别能力较强的特征,形 成树分类器;
[0012] 3)构造森林分类器,即由多个树分类器生成一个森林分类器;
[0013] 4)构造集成森林分类器,即由多个森林分类器生成集成森林分类器;
[0014] 5)使用集成森林分类器对行人进行检测。
[0015] 上述方法中,所述步骤1)中的样本分为正例样本和反例样本,正例样本是指含有 行人的图像,反例样本是指不含有行人的图像,正例样本和反例样本均统一为相同尺寸大 小的图像。
[0016] 上述方法中,所述步骤1)的特征设计包括以下过程:
[0017] 11)计算样本随机特征;
[0018] 12)计算特征序列概率分布直方图。
[0019] 上述方法中,所述步骤11)包括以下具体步骤:
[0020] 111)针对样本图像随机初始化fn个的相同大小的区域块,fn的取值范围为 1000?10000,每个区域块随机初始化tn个的坐标点对,这里可以设tn = {4, 8, 16, 32};
[0021] 112)针对每一个区域块,计算坐标点对的像素差值,若差值大于在自定义的阈值 p,则该坐标点对的形成的特征值为1,反之为0,因此,每个区域块的特征是由0和1组成, 长度为tn的序列;
[0022] 113)对于每一个样本图像,计算fn个区域块的特征,所有区域块的特征最终形成 样本图像的特征T。特征T是由fn个长度为tn的序列组成。
[0023] 上述方法中,所述步骤12)包括以下具体步骤:
[0024] 121)对于第i个特征序列,其二进制值为Vi,统计该序列值分别在正例样本和反 例样本中出现的次数,其值分别为I;·,p;
[0025] 122)将其对应的二进制值进行归一化处理,方法如下: =L" / nn
[0026] ° ° ° ⑴ L',* =L^ / rtj
[0027] 其中,1?为正例样本个数,&为反例样本个数;
[0028] 123)重复上述步骤121)?步骤122)直至计算完所有的fn个特征序列为止,得到

【权利要求】
1. 一种多特征融合的行人检测方法,其特征在于包括以下步骤: 1) 特征设计,即对于输入样本图像计算随机特征,统计特征概率分布直方图; 2) 构造树分类器,即从多个特征概率分布直方图中选择判别能力较强的特征,形成树 分类器; 3) 构造森林分类器,即由多个树分类器生成一个森林分类器; 4) 构造集成森林分类器,即由多个森林分类器生成集成森林分类器; 5) 使用集成森林分类器对行人进行检测。
2. 根据权利要求1所述的多特征融合的行人检测方法,其特征在于所述步骤1)中的样 本分为正例样本和反例样本,正例样本是指含有行人的图像,反例样本是指不含有行人的 图像,正例样本和反例样本均统一为相同尺寸大小的图像。 所述步骤1)特征设计包括以下步骤: 11) 计算样本随机特征; 12) 计算特征序列概率分布直方图。
3. 根据权利要求2所述的多特征融合的行人检测方法,其特征在于所述步骤11)包括 以下具体步骤: 111) 针对样本图像随机初始化fn个的相同大小的区域块,fn的取值范围为1000? 10000,每个区域块随机初始化tn个的坐标点对,设tn = {4, 8, 16, 32}; 112) 针对每一个区域块,计算坐标点对的像素差值,若差值大于在自定义的阈值P, 则该坐标点对的形成的特征值为1,反之为0,因此,每个区域块的特征是由0和1组成,长 度为tn的序列; 113) 对于每一个样本图像,计算fn个区域块的特征,所有区域块的特征最终形成样本 图像的特征T,特征T是由fn个长度为tn的序列组成。
4. 根据权利要求2所述的多特征融合的行人检测方法,其特征在于所述步骤12)包括 以下具体步骤: 121) 对于第i个特征序列,其二进制值为Vi,统计该序列值分别在正例样本和反例样 本中出现的次数,其值分别为L》,L?; 122) 将其对应的二进制值进行归一化处理,方法如下: Lo=Lo ⑴ =V{ / nx 其中,1?为正例样本个数,ni为反例样本个数; 123) 重复上述步骤121)?步骤122)直至计算完所有的fn个特征序列为止,得到
124) 在U和Q中,其最大值分别记为列对应的最大值和Pm,若,则记ρπ = PmO, Pi = 0 ;若 PmO 彡 pnl,则记 Pm = Pm, Pi = 1 ; 125) 若pm小于阈值P则pm = 0, Pl = -1。
5. 根据权利要求1所述的多特征融合的行人检测方法,其特征在于所述步骤2)构造树 分类器包括以下具体步骤: 21)在构造树分类器之前,树分类器为空,对于含有1?个正例样本,其每一个正例样本 初始化权重为Di = 0. 5/rv对于含有]^个反例样本,其每一个反例样本初始化权重为Di = 0. 5/n1 ; 22) 对于第i个特征序列,第j个样本图像在该特征序列下对应的标签为Pl,若样本标 签与Pl不同,则需计算错误率,方法如下: ei = ei+Dj (2) 23) 重复步骤22)直至计算完所有的正例样本和反例样本为止; 24) 重复步骤21)?步骤22)直至计算完所有fn个特征序列为止,并标记其最小错误 率对应的特征序列ind ; 25) 对于第j个样本图像,若样本标签与特征序列ind所对应的Pi不同,则更新样本权 重为,方法如下:
(3) 若样本标签与特征序列ind所对应的?1相同,则更新权重为:
(4) 26) 重复以上步骤25)直至所有的正例样本和反例样本计算完毕为止; 27) 正例样本和反例样本进行归一化权重,正例样本归一化方法如下:
(5) 反例样本归一化方法如下:
(6) 28) 将该特征序列ind加入到树分类器中。重复步骤25)?步骤27)直至Cff特征序 列加入到树分类器中,最终形成树分类器。
6. 根据权利要求1所述的多特征融合的行人检测方法,其特征在于所述步骤3)构造森 林分类器包括以下具体步骤: 31) 在构造森林分类器之前,森林分类器为空,初始化树分类器个数为nt_,每个树分 类器所含特征序列个数为c f ; 32) 对于第i个树分类器,按照上述步骤1)和步骤2)构造树分类器; 33) 重复上述步骤32)直至所有树分类器构造完毕,最终形成森林分类器。
7. 根据权利要求1所述的多特征融合的行人检测方法,其特征在于所述步骤4)包括以 下具体步骤: 41) 在构造集成森林分类器之前,集成森林分类器为空,初始化森林的个数nfOTe;st ; 42) 对于第i个森林分类器,按照上述步骤3)构造森林分类器; 43) 重复上述步骤42)直至所有森林分类器构造完毕,最终形成集成森林分类器。
8. 根据权利要求1所述的多特征融合的行人检测方法,其特征在于所述步骤5)包括以 下具体步骤: 51) 对于树分类器中的第i个特征序列,根据步骤11)计算该特征序列的特征值; 52) 该特征序列对应标签为Pl,若Pl不等于-1则计算下该标签的分数,方法如下:
(7) 53) 重复以上步骤51)?52)直至该树分类器的所有(^个特征序列计算完为止; 54) 根据以上步骤51)?步骤53)得到最大的分数及其对应的标签; 55) 对于森林分类器中第i个树分类器,按照步骤51)?步骤54)计算得到标签,并对 标签进行计数; 56) 重复步骤55)直至所有的nt_个树分类器计算完毕为止,比较正例标签和反例标 签所对应的分数,记录最大的分数和该分数对应的标签; 57) 对于集成森林分类器中的第i个森林分类器,按照步骤56)计算的到标签,并对标 签进行计数; 58) 重复步骤57)直至所有的nfOTest个森林分类器计算完毕为止,比较正例标签和反例 标签所对应的分数,记录最大的分数和该分数对应的标签。
【文档编号】G06K9/62GK104050460SQ201410307455
【公开日】2014年9月17日 申请日期:2014年6月30日 优先权日:2014年6月30日
【发明者】刘亚洲, 袁文, 孙权森 申请人:南京理工大学
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1